For many groups, sauna is not an extra detail but one of the things that changes the feel of the whole weekend. It creates a slower rhythm, gives people another place to gather and makes winter stays and off-season weekends much more appealing.
The Scheuermatthof chalet already offers the right mountain setting, but the sauna strengthens its appeal for groups that want more than a practical sleeping base. It turns the house into a place where people genuinely enjoy spending the evening.
